THE last Goodwood Cup winner to attempt to follow up in the St Leger? Stradivarius. Beat his elders at Goodwood in 2017, getting the 13lb age allowance, and ran well in the Leger but just came up short, rallying on the inside but ultimately finishing a half a length behind the Irish Derby winner Capri, and a short-head behind the subsequent Prince of Wales’s Stakes winner Crystal Ocean.

He was a length and a half in front of subsequent Melbourne Cup winner Rekindling too, in one of the hottest renewals of the oldest classic run in years.
